Re: Subarrays



>> Is there a scientific requirement for the software to enable the observer
to
>> shuffle antennas flexibly from one subarray to another?


There is an operational requirement. If we plan to continue observing while
moving
antennas around and re-calibrating their parameters (pointing, coordinates),
the
software must be flexible enough to allow re-connecting any antenna to any
sub-array when needed. This is an operator requirement, not an observer's
one.

There are quite a number of details related to the sub-arrays (e.g. deleay
reference, bandpass calibration, etc...) which we will have to sort out.
Need a more global view of the operation to do so.
